Louis Vuitton Supply Chain Transformation Project Assistant Intern
Louis Vuitton, a distinguished name in the luxury fashion industry, is part of the LVMH conglomerate, renowned for its commitment to excellence and innovation. As an employer, Louis Vuitton offers a dynamic and enriching environment where employees are encouraged to explore, develop, and innovate. The brand is dedicated to sustainability and diversity, ensuring a positive impact on both the company and society.
- Assist the Knowledge Manager in implementing and deploying new communication and training tools within the Supply Chain, both in France and globally.
- Gather requirements, plan, define short and medium-term objectives, launch, monitor performance, and collect feedback.
- Collaborate closely with Product Owners and Supply Chain experts to stay informed about technological advancements and improvements.
- Contribute to change management initiatives and support their implementation.
- Propose and develop new, engaging communication formats.
- Participate in the design and organization of training sessions.
- Engage in communication activities highlighting Supply Chain operations, agility, projects, and training offerings.
- Create communication content and organize events to strengthen the Supply Chain community.
- Participate in additional projects or tasks based on profile and interests, such as analysis, business intelligence, and development.
- Currently enrolled in a general engineering school with a specialization in logistics, Supply Chain, or industrial engineering.
- Strong interest and aptitude for communication and design.
- Excellent interpersonal skills and ability to work with diverse stakeholders.
- Proficiency in quantitative data analysis and synthesis.
- Creativity, curiosity, excellent communication, pedagogical skills, and ability to simplify complex information.
- Fluency in English, both written and spoken.
- Knowledge of communication techniques (articles, videos, podcasts, social media) is a plus.
- Video editing skills are advantageous.
- Familiarity with infographics and graphic design is beneficial.
No prior experience required, suitable for beginners.
Currently pursuing a degree in engineering, logistics, Supply Chain, or industrial engineering.
